'Evil Prophecy' (PS2) Ships To Stores

by Rainier on June 15, 2004 @ 11:30 a.m. PDT

Konami today announced that it has shipped McFarlane's Evil Prophecy for the PlayStation 2 to retail outlets nationwide. The action-fighting game brings to life the popular McFarlane's Monsters line of action figures from McFarlane Toys. Players will battle hundreds of monsters, including six boss enemies from the action figure series featuring Dracula, Mummy, Werewolf, Frankenstein, Sea Creature and Voodoo Queen.

Set in the early 19th Century, McFarlane's Evil Prophecy thrust players into a time when six evil forces have awakened, setting off a string of unexplained phenomena occurring worldwide. A team of four McFarlane-designed monster hunters with magical powers set out to destroy the deadly creatures before they shroud the world in darkness. Players will control all four hunters as they venture through six expansive worlds and over 30 stages to save humanity from the clutches of evil.

In McFarlane's Evil Prophecy, gamers can choose to face the army of monsters alone or battle in the cooperative multi-player mode. The game delivers real time party-based melee combat with up to three other gamers via the Multitap for PlayStation®2. Players can assume the role of four unique characters, each armed with an arsenal of deadly moves as well as their own strengths and weaknesses. Add the in-depth combo attack system and gamers will be on the edge of their seat as they fight through a slew of frightening monsters.

In addition to the intense gameplay, McFarlane's Evil Prophecy features exclusive content from renowned artist/creator and McFarlane Toys CEO, Todd McFarlane, including artwork, interviews and more.

McFarlane's Evil Prophecy is rated "M" for Mature by the ESRB and is available at retail outlets nationwide for an SRP of $39.99. To learn more about McFarlane's Evil Prophecy, please visit the official Evil Prophecy website.
